HC Deb 22 May 1884 vol 288 c991
CAPTAIN PRICE

asked the Secretary to the Admiralty, Whether it is a fact that, on the 4th June next, there will be only three General Officers of Royal Marines eligible for employment under Army Rules, out of a total of fourteen Generals; and if there is any intention of retiring those Officers who cannot again be employed, as is done in the case of every other branch of the service?

MR. CAMPBELL-BANNERMAN

In answer to my hon. and gallant Friend I have to say that the statement of fact in the first part of his Question is correct. There is no intention to assimilate the Rules as to pay and retirement of General Officers of Royal Marines to those affecting General Officers in the Army.
